Specifications of EPDM Waterproof Membrane with Recycled Material for Pond Cover:

 

MaterialEPDM Rubber
Size1.2m (width)*20m (length) or customized, weldable type 2.05m or 4m width
Thick1.2mm, 1.5mm, 2.0mm
TypeVulcanized & Weldable
PatternNon-reinforced (homogeneous)
CertificateISO9001/14001

Q: Can a waterproofing membrane be used on plywood?
Yes, a waterproofing membrane can be used on plywood. Plywood is a commonly used material in construction and is often used as a subfloor or as a base for various types of flooring. However, plywood is not naturally waterproof and can be susceptible to damage from moisture. To protect plywood from water damage, a waterproofing membrane can be applied to the surface. These membranes are designed to create a barrier that prevents water from penetrating the plywood, keeping it dry and preventing rot or mold growth. Waterproofing membranes can be used in various applications such as bathrooms, kitchens, decks, and roofs. It is important to choose a waterproofing membrane that is suitable for plywood and to follow the manufacturer's instructions for proper installation to ensure the best results.
Q: Can a waterproofing membrane be applied on vertical surfaces?
Yes, a waterproofing membrane can be applied on vertical surfaces. In fact, waterproofing membranes are often used on vertical surfaces such as exterior walls, retaining walls, and foundations to prevent water penetration and protect the underlying structure. These membranes are specifically designed to adhere to vertical surfaces and create a barrier against moisture. They are typically applied in multiple layers to ensure maximum waterproofing effectiveness. Additionally, there are various types of waterproofing membranes available, including liquid-applied, sheet-applied, and spray-applied membranes, which can be tailored to different vertical surfaces and construction requirements.
Q: Can a waterproofing membrane prevent mold and mildew growth?
A waterproofing membrane has the ability to prevent the growth of mold and mildew. Mold and mildew thrive in areas that are damp and moist, but waterproofing membranes act as a barrier that stops water from seeping into the surfaces below. By ensuring that the area remains dry, the membrane reduces the conditions needed for mold and mildew to grow. Furthermore, certain waterproofing membranes are specifically designed to have antimicrobial properties, which further hinder the growth of mold and mildew. However, it is important to remember that while a waterproofing membrane can help prevent mold and mildew growth, it is not a guaranteed solution. Proper ventilation and maintenance are also essential in preventing these problems.
Q: Are there any specific considerations for installing a waterproofing membrane on stucco surfaces?
Installing a waterproofing membrane on stucco surfaces requires careful consideration. Firstly, the stucco surface must be thoroughly cleaned and free from any dirt, debris, or loose material. This can be achieved by either power washing or scrubbing the surface with a stiff brush and water. Secondly, it is crucial to select the appropriate waterproofing membrane for stucco surfaces. Various options are available, including liquid-applied membranes, sheet membranes, or peel-and-stick membranes. It is imperative to choose a membrane that is compatible with stucco and offers a strong and durable barrier against water penetration. Another aspect to consider is the proper application technique. The membrane should be evenly and smoothly applied to ensure complete coverage over the entire stucco surface. It is important to follow the manufacturer's instructions and guidelines for the specific membrane being used. Additionally, special attention should be given to details and transitions, such as areas around windows, doors, vents, or other penetrations. These vulnerable points are more prone to water infiltration, so it is essential to adequately seal and waterproof them using additional techniques or products, such as flashing or caulking. Furthermore, the climate and weather conditions in the area must be taken into account. If the stucco surface is exposed to extreme temperatures or frequent freeze-thaw cycles, it is advisable to choose a waterproofing membrane that can withstand these conditions and provide long-lasting protection. Lastly, regular inspection and maintenance of the waterproofing membrane are vital to ensure its effectiveness over time. It is recommended to periodically check for any signs of damage, such as cracking, peeling, or bubbling, and promptly address any issues to prevent water infiltration and potential damage to the stucco surface. In conclusion, when installing a waterproofing membrane on stucco surfaces, it is necessary to clean the surface, select the appropriate membrane, apply it correctly, pay attention to details and transitions, consider the climate, and regularly inspect and maintain the membrane for long-term protection against water penetration.

Q: Can a waterproofing membrane be painted or coated?
Yes, a waterproofing membrane can be painted or coated. However, it is essential to use a paint or coating specifically designed for use on waterproofing membranes. These types of paints or coatings are typically elastomeric, meaning they can stretch and move with the membrane without cracking or peeling. Additionally, the paint or coating should be compatible with the waterproofing membrane material to ensure proper adhesion and longevity. Before applying any paint or coating, it is advisable to clean and prepare the surface according to the manufacturer's instructions. It is also crucial to follow the recommended application process and allow sufficient drying and curing time for the paint or coating. Overall, painting or coating a waterproofing membrane can enhance its appearance, provide additional protection against UV rays and environmental elements, and extend its lifespan.

Q: Can a waterproofing membrane be used for wastewater facilities?
Indeed, wastewater facilities necessitate a strong safeguard against the potentially harmful and corrosive effects of wastewater. By employing a waterproofing membrane, the infiltration of water, which can result in structural harm, deterioration, and contamination of surrounding areas, can be effectively prevented. Waterproofing membranes act as a barrier, shielding the facility's walls, floors, and foundations from the intrusion of water and moisture. This serves to uphold the structure's integrity, prevent leaks, and guard against corrosion stemming from the presence of chemicals in wastewater. Furthermore, certain waterproofing membranes not only safeguard against water and chemical damage but also exhibit resistance to UV rays, high temperatures, and freeze-thaw cycles. This is particularly significant for wastewater facilities situated in regions characterized by extreme weather conditions. All in all, employing a waterproofing membrane in wastewater facilities is a dependable and efficient means of ensuring long-term protection against water damage, preserving the structural integrity, and augmenting the facility's durability.
